Il n'y a pas de secret sur la finale de cette série: la couverture du tome 11 est assez parlante. J'avais posté une critique sur le tome 1 qui résumait ma lecture du début de cette série, mais je tenais à ajouter un point sur l'évolution et la finale.
En effet, au tome 5, l'arc de départ se termine, avec la confession et les excuses de leur faux mariage. C'est le début alors de leur vrai engagement de couple: ce qui inclut toutes les premières fois, donc s'embrasser, se toucher, se présenter à la famille, coucher ensemble, gérer la conciliation des attentes et aspirations de l'autre, mais aussi des parents... Il y a une vraie réflexion sur la vie d'enfant qu'on a eue, les déceptions qui ont orienté nos choix, et ce qu'on devient comme adulte. En guérissant un peu peut-être de ces relations parfois difficiles remplies de non-dits, avec les parents. C'est surtout cela que les tomes 6 à 11 vont aborder, à travers plusieurs bonnes questions et moments émouvants (vive la grand-mère!)
Bref, une belle comédie romantique pour un couple adorable! :)
